-GENERAL-
I. The contractor shall verify and be responsible for:
a. All Contract Documents.
b. Omissions and/or conflicts between the various elements of
the Contract Documents.
c. All dimensions and conditions hit the site.
d. Any condition which in his opinion might endanger the
stability of the structure.
e. Ensuring proper alignment of the final structure.
The contractor shall limtetediately notify the Architect/Designer
and the Structural ]Engineer of any discrepancy or omission before
proceeding with the work.
2• All work shall conform to the minimum standards of the
!; - Gr�(► Soot Edition, and all other regulating agencies
e:xerdsing .authority over any portion of the work, including the
State of California, Division of industrial Safety and Cal/OSHA.
3. All work shall conform to the best practice prevailing in the various
trades comprising the work.
4. Any ASTM( designations shall be as amended.to date.
5. The contractor shall provide temporary erection bracing and shoring
for all structural members or as required for structural stability of the
structure during all phases of construction.
6. On -site verification of all dimensions and conditions shah be the
responsibility of the contractor (sub -contractor). Noted dimensions
take precedence over scale.
7. Specific details and notes shalt talcs precedence over general notes
and details..
